07707118479 Summary (Read all comments)
Phone number ☎️ 07707118479 👆 is reported as linked to scam text messages pretending to be from the DVLA, often containing invites to renew driving licences or set up voicemail. Users have noted the messages were poorly written and aimed at tricking people into downloading apps or clicking suspicious links. Several warnings highlight these as phishing attempts, strongly advising against interacting with them.
